Disproportionate Minority Confinement: 2002 Update
Describes developments in addressing disproportionate minority confinement (DMC) at the national, state, and local levels. This OJJDP Summary begins with a brief review of the most recent data, followed by an outline of national efforts by OJJDP and others during the past 5 years to address the challenge of DMC. It then presents an update of state activities, including a status report on state compliance with the DMC core requirement, highlights form state DMC assessment research and intervention initiatives, and an outline of remaining challenges. The Summary concludes with a look at the implications of the Juvenile Justice and Delinquency Prevention Act's broadening of DMC to encompass disproportionate minority contact.
Disproportionate Minority Confinement: A Review of the Research Literature From 1989 Through 2001
The purpose of this 2002 OJJDP Bulletin is to extend earlier analysis by examining research found in professional academic journals and edited books during the 12-year period. Conference papers or presentations are excluded from the current review, as are unpublished State studies or plans, except when portions of these may have formed the basis for a journal publication.
